ZIP Code 64445: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 64445?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 64445 is $98,100, lower than 83%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 64445?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 64445 is $638, an effective rate of 1%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 64445 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 64445 cost about 1.47× the median household income, lower than 84%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 64445?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 64445 is $620 a month, lower than 73%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 64445?
- ZIP Code 64445 averages 50.3°F year-round, summer highs near 84.1°F, winter lows around 15.2°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 22.8 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 64445 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 64445's FEMA National Risk Index score is 77.7 (higher than 67%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is tornado.
